Why Choose a Career in Cleaning and Hygiene?

The cleaning and hygiene field has become one of the most reliable sectors in South Africa. Every public and private space depends on trained professionals to maintain safety and health standards.

Some key reasons this field offers long-term opportunities include:

  • Public health impact: Proper cleaning practices reduce the spread of diseases.
  • High demand: Hygiene is required in hospitals, hotels, schools, offices, and industrial facilities.
  • Job stability: Unlike many industries, cleaning services remain essential regardless of economic conditions.

By joining this programme, you are positioning yourself in a career where your skills will always be needed.

About the Cleaning and Hygiene Learning Program 2025

The programme runs for 12 months and combines classroom-based training with supervised workplace exposure. This structure ensures that learners not only understand theory but also apply it in real-world environments.

Programme Structure

  • Classroom learning: Modules covering cleaning techniques, sanitation practices, and occupational health.
  • Practical training: On-site training under the guidance of professionals.
  • Work readiness: Soft skills such as time management, teamwork, and communication.

Skills You Will Gain

By the end of the programme, participants will be able to:

  • Use modern cleaning equipment and chemicals safely.
  • Apply waste management practices.
  • Understand occupational health and safety requirements.
  • Carry out hygiene and infection control methods.
  • Work professionally in customer-facing environments.

Career Pathways After Completion

Once the programme ends, graduates will be equipped for employment in a wide range of industries, including:

  • Healthcare: Hospitals, clinics, and laboratories.
  • Hospitality: Hotels, resorts, and restaurants.
  • Corporate and commercial spaces: Office parks, malls, and schools.
  • Industrial sites: Factories, warehouses, and logistics hubs.

There are also clear progression routes:

  • Entry-level cleaner
  • Team leader
  • Supervisor
  • Facilities manager

Specialised fields such as biohazard cleaning or healthcare hygiene may also be pursued with experience.
